U.S. Consumers Seen As Listless Hagglers Except When Literally Driving A Good Deal


U.S, consumers generally like to haggle over price less than their peers around the world, according to a new report. But when it comes to buying a new car, that really gets Americans’ motors spinning, says the research firm picodi. Overall, Indonesia takes the gold in haggling with 66 percent of adults enjoying the sport. Brazilians, Italians and Canadians get the most worked up in battling for gym workout discounts. Filipinos are the spiciest in refusing to fork over the asking price for food.
